Skip to content

fisher44123/MyLucy

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

5 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

MyLucy

一个简洁、高效的 Windows 快捷启动器,专为提升生产力而生。

MyLucy Logo

✨ 项目背景

作为非程序员出身的小白,得益于 Vibe Coding,我成功做出了人生中的第一个项目(虽然很粗糙,但是我也很开心)。

做 MyLucy 的起因仅仅是因为我想给 Lucy 的标签快捷方式添加非组合键启动,包括鼠标中键。但是因为 Lucy 并没有开源,而且原作者也联系不上,我只好一张张截图发给 Agent 让它一步步修改。

在这个过程中,我耗费了 Codex App 的一周额度,Antigravity 的所有模型额度,外加 Trae Pro 的 21 美金额度,总计大约 400 元😢。

总而言之,我还是比较满意的。希望有大佬如果有机会能用上这个,抽空帮忙完善,让我虚心学习。

🚀 功能特性

  • 极速启动:优化的启动流程,告别卡顿。
  • 快捷键支持:支持非组合键启动,支持自定义全局热键。
  • 鼠标中键支持:专为鼠标中键优化的操作逻辑。
  • 系统工具集成:内置截图、取色器、尺子等实用小工具。
    • 输入 #截图#screenshot 启动截图。
    • 输入 #颜色#color 启动取色器。
    • 输入 #尺子#ruler 启动屏幕尺子。
  • AI 助手集成:支持简单的 AI 问答(输入 / 开头)。
  • 完全本地化:所有数据存储在本地 SQLite 数据库中,安全可控。

📦 安装与运行

直接运行

  1. 通过git命令或者下载压缩包。
  2. 解压后运行 MyLucy_Fixed.exe 即可。

源码编译

  1. 确保安装了 .NET 8 SDK
  2. 克隆本项目:
    git clone https://github.com/yourusername/MyLucy.git
  3. 打开 MyLucy.sln(推荐使用 Visual Studio 2022 或 Trae/VS Code)。
  4. 编译并运行。

🛠️ 项目结构

  • src/MyLucy: 主程序源码 (WPF)
  • tools/IconConverter: 辅助工具源码
  • docs/: 开发文档与设计理念
  • assets/: 资源文件

🤝 贡献指南

作为一个初学者的项目,代码中肯定有很多不完善的地方。非常欢迎各位大佬提交 Issue 或 Pull Request 来帮助改进 MyLucy!

无论是代码重构、功能添加,还是文档完善,您的每一次贡献都将帮助我更好地学习和成长。

📄 开源协议

本项目采用 MIT License 开源。

About

开源版Luc

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ors